webfact Posted April 19, 2019 Share Posted April 19, 2019 Big Oud in, Big Joke out: Thailand names new Immigration chief video screenshot Thailand’s Immigration Bureau has a new commander. Pol Maj Gen Sompong Chingduang will now head up the Bureau, replacing outgoing immigraiton chief Surachate Harkparn, also known as Big Joke, who in a surprise move earlier this month was stripped of police duties and transferred to a role within the civil service. Pol Maj Gen Sompong Chingduang, known as ‘Big Oud’ in the Thai media, was once dubbed “the crime buster of Bangkok”, following his work as a former deputy commissioner at the Metropolitan Police Bureau. In October 2018, he was appointed chief of the Border Patrol Police, and as a result was promoted to police lieutenant general. He had also worked at the Crime Suppression Division in southern Thailand and been a district police chief in Narathiwat. He transfers from the Border Patrol Police to the Immigration Bureau. Meanwhile, Spring News reported that deputy prime minister Prawit said that no investigation or further information will be released regarding the shock removal of Surachate Harkparn from the Immigration Bureau. Earlier this week it was reported that Surachate Harkparn is currently on vacation in the United States.
